Freigeben über


Microsoft.VisualStudio.Uml.CommonBehaviors-Namespace

Dieser Namespace definiert die wichtigsten Konzepte der Meldungen, Vorgangsaufrufe und Ereignisse. Weitere Informationen zur UML-API finden Sie unter Erweitern von UML-Modellen und Diagrammen.

Die in diesem Namespace definierten Typen und Eigenschaften entsprechen denen, die in der UML-Spezifikation definiert werden. Darüber hinaus werden Erweiterungsmethoden für viele Typen in diesem Namespace definiert. Weitere Informationen finden Sie unter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ml.

Schnittstellen

  Schnittstelle Beschreibung
Öffentliche Schnittstelle IBehavior Eine partielle Definition der Zustandsänderung von Objekten im Laufe der Zeit.Bildet einen Teil der Definition eines Klassifizierers.Beispielsweise sind Aktivitäten, Interaktionen und Vorgänge Verhalten.
Öffentliche Schnittstelle IBehavioredClassifier Eine Beschreibung oder teilweise Beschreibung von Objekten, die sich entsprechend einer Auflistung von Vorgängen, Zustände und anderen Funktionen verhalten.
Öffentliche Schnittstelle ICallEvent Der Empfang von einem Objekt einer Nachricht, die einen Vorgang aufruft.
Öffentliche Schnittstelle IEvent Die Angabe einiger Vorkommen, die Aktionen durch ein Objekt auslösen kann.
Öffentliche Schnittstelle IMessageEvent Gibt die Bestätigung entweder eines Aufrufs oder eines Signals durch ein Objekt an.

Enumerationen

  Enumeration Beschreibung
Öffentliche Enumeration CallConcurrencyKind Definiert, wie der Besitzer eines Vorgangs gleichzeitige Aufrufe behandelt.